Lead .NET Developer

Ifindtech Ltd
Charing Cross, United Kingdom
23 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ior

Job location

Charing Cross, United Kingdom

Tech stack

.NET
Agile Methodologies
Artificial Intelligence
Amazon Web Services (AWS)
Amazon Web Services (AWS)
Amazon Web Services (AWS)
C Sharp (Programming Language)
Cloud Computing
Code Review
Databases
Continuous Integration
Software Design Patterns
DevOps
Amazon DynamoDB
Event-Driven Programming
NoSQL
Service-Oriented Architecture
SQL Databases
Web Applications
Amazon Web Services (AWS)
Containerization
Angular
Solid Principles
Infrastructure Automation Frameworks
Functional Programming
Api Gateway
Amazon Web Services (AWS)
Microservices

Job description

As an Engineering Lead, you will join a high performing Technology and Data organisation, leading multiple engineering teams across strategic initiatives. You will collaborate closely with Product, QA, and cross functional stakeholders to deliver scalable, secure, and future proof solutions that meet business needs, quality expectations, and long term technical standards.

Requirements

Do you have experience in UX?, Proven experience leading and mentoring engineering teams in a modern software environment

Strong hands on background building .NET/C# and Angular web applications

Deep understanding of modern architecture patterns (microservices, event driven systems, service oriented architecture)

Cloud native development expertise with AWS services (Lambda, API Gateway, EC2, S3, RDS, DynamoDB, SQS/SNS)

Solid DevOps knowledge including CI/CD, infrastructure as code, and containerisation

Strong experience delivering software in Agile environments with a focus on quality and user experience

Strong database skills across SQL and NoSQL systems

Commitment to engineering best practices including SOLID principles, design patterns, code reviews, and testing

Experience with observability, monitoring, alerting, and production readiness

Excellent communication skills, able to explain technical trade offs to both technical and non technical stakeholders

Practical, delivery focused mindset with the ability to remove bottlenecks and drive outcomes

Nice to Haves:

Exposure to AI/ML tools, automation, and modern engineering accelerators

Experience embedding AI driven workflows or intelligent automation into product delivery

Background in trading, financial platforms, or other high performance regulated environments

Experience assessing and adopting emerging technologies pragmatically

Track record of driving continuous improvement across processes, tooling, and team capability

Apply for this position